LaVive were a German girl group consisting of Meike Ehnert, Sarah Rensing, Julia Köster and Katrin Mehlberg that was formed on the television show Popstars: Girls forever. Their debut album No Sleep was released in December 2010.

The single "I Swear" was released in November 2010 featuring the final eleven contestants of Popstars: Girls forever, and the single "No Time for Sleeping" was released in December 2010.[1] After LaViVe's record-deal with record label Starwatch/Warner expired in March 2011, Warner did not renew it, which led to the group's disbandment.
